Description of Duties:

Serves as assistant project leader for South Florida Aquatic Resources Project - Okeechobee. Assist in the design of studies and monitoring activities to document and evaluate the biological characteristics of aquatic flora and fauna in Lake Okeechobee . Project lead for field implementation of studies and monitoring activities, and management of acquired biological data and metadata. Conducts appropriate statistical analyses of data, and prepares periodic technical reports and papers of scientific findings. Develops and implements management strategies for optimum resource use and sustained, long-term productivity of the aquatic resources of Lake Okeechobee . Courteously assists Commission constituents to resolve questions or problems they may have in matters relating to the Commission, it’s programs or fish and wildlife conservation, generally. Seeks to garner public support for agency objectives and programs by serving Florida ’s citizens in a positive and pro-active manner. Responsible for timely and accurate processing and or approval, as appropriate, of vendor invoices and warrants for payment of goods received or services rendered to avoid automatic interest penalty payments to said vendors. Responsible for adhering to the provisions and requirements of Section 215.422, F.S., related to State Comptroller’s rules and Florida Fish and Wildlife Conservation Commission invoice processing and warrant distribution procedures.

Level of Education:

A bachelor's degree from an accredited college or university with a major in one of the biological sciences and one year of professional biological experience in a field or laboratory program; or
Master's degree from an accredited college or university in one of the biological sciences
